Holland Intermediate Celebrates “Start With Hello Week” with Spirit and Success Recently at Holland Intermediate, we celebrated “Start With Hello Week,” a national initiative designed to foster kindness, empathy and connection among students. The message is simple, yet powerful: encouraging our students to greet one another, promote inclusivity and cultivate positive communication skills. Throughout the week, students are learning the importance of understanding empathy, practicing positive communication and appreciating diversity within our school community.

Each day brought a new opportunity to engage in these lessons while adding a bit of fun. Students embraced themed dress days, showing up in their favorite pajamas, sports jerseys and even dressing for success, creating a vibrant and energetic atmosphere throughout the school. These themes were not just about fun, but served as a way for students to express themselves and connect with their peers.
